Attenuation of fluctuations by an external field in a correlated walk

Correlated walk in the presence of an external field is applied to the study of diffusion coefficients in simple cubic lattices. A continuous time distribution is introduced with the aid of the pausing time distribution developed by Montroll. An exact expression for the diffusion coefficient is derived for perfect cubic lattices. It is found that the external field attenuates the effects of the rms deviations. These results are used to discuss the atomic diffusion in cubic lattices with impurities, which act as traps. Comparison with previous experimental and theoretical results is made and discussed.
